The Plumas Sierra County Fair (PSCF) Foundation is set to host one of its renowned Socials, and it is extending an open invitation to all community members.
Traditionally reserved for its members, the PSCF Foundation is breaking tradition by welcoming the entire community to join in the festivities. Attendees can expect a delightful array of snacks and beverages and engaging activities like bingo.
A highlight of the evening will be an informative talk on the history of the Plumas Sierra County Fair, to be delivered by none other than Fair Manager John Steffanic. Steffanic, well-versed in the fair’s heritage, will share the stories and memories of the county’s longest-running, most loved event in Plumas history.
The event is scheduled for today, April 30, starting at 6:00 p.m. You can attend in the Mineral Building at the Fairgrounds. Admission to the Social is free of charge.
